What would happen if you were to see a friend one day then when you get back to school you are called to a room with tons of your friends and you find out that the someone you just saw committed suicide. how would you react. in this story you see how a few different teenagers deal with finding out that their best friend is gone and you see how a young sister deals with it after finally meeting her older sister for the first time in 5-6 years barely a week before. read to find out
